Johnnie Walker

Johnnie Walker traces its origins back to 1820, when John Walker opened a small grocery shop in Kilmarnock, Scotland. From this humble beginning, Walker began blending whiskies with remarkable skill and ambition. The brand grew steadily through the generations, with his son Alexander and grandson Alexander II expanding the business well beyond Scotland's borders. In 1908, the iconic Striding Man logo was introduced, and the 'Johnnie Walker' brand name was formally adopted — milestones that helped cement the brand's identity as it grew into a global phenomenon. Today, Johnnie Walker is the world's leading blended Scotch whisky, owned by drinks giant Diageo. The portfolio is built around a colour-coded label system, ranging from the approachable Red Label and the classic Black Label, through to the premium Gold Label Reserve, the ultra-rare Blue Label, and special releases such as the Legendary Eight — a blend of whiskies from eight iconic Scottish distilleries, created to commemorate the brand's 200-year legacy. Each expression reflects the brand's hallmark style: bold, complex, and consistently crafted blends designed to appeal to a wide range of palates. With over two centuries of history, Johnnie Walker remains a benchmark in the world of blended Scotch. The brand celebrated its 200th anniversary in 2020, reaffirming its status as one of the most recognisable and enduring names in whisky worldwide.
